Jennifer Fandel dives into the fascinating world of monarchy, exploring its intricacies and variations. Readers are invited to uncover the distinctive features that set absolute monarchies apart from constitutional ones, making complex political structures accessible and engaging.
Through a thoughtful narrative, she guides them through rich historical contexts and pivotal moments that shaped monarchies around the globe. Her passion for the subject shines through, making it not only informative but also a delightful read for anyone curious about governance.
With warmth and clarity, Fandel's insightful observations encourage readers to reflect on how the echoes of monarchy still resonate in today's political landscape.
